#604357 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#604357 is composed of 37.6% red, 26.3% green and 34.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 30.2% magenta, 9.4%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 318.6 degrees, a saturation of 17.8% and a lightness of 32%. #604357 color hex could be obtained by blending #c086ae with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

● #604357 color description : Very dark grayish pink.
#604357 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#604357 has RGB values of R:96, G:67, B:87 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.3, Y:0.09,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 6308695.
